Ford’s Well Recreation Area is located on the south side of Enid Lake. This recreation area is designed for horse enthusiasts to be able to camp with their horses and to ride a 20.8 mile horse trail. The campground features eighteen campsites with full hook-ups, a shower house, dump station, picnic shelter, playground, six picnic sites, five interpretive buildings that date back to the early 1900s, and a 20.8 mile equestrian trail.
